I've just had the bedroom decorated and fitted with new wardrobes. The new storage has certainly given a more streamline look also helped by a massive declutter.

The room is just feeling a bit blah, and whilst I don't want a lot of stuff, I just want to add a little luxury and personal touch.

Any ideas?

A large plant, nice artwork, big plump beautiful cushions and throw. A well dressed bed is key

hivemindneeded · 06/12/2021 16:25

Beautiful print or painting over the bed. Stylish bedside lamps. A beautiful throw. A really good overhead lampshade.

I hate cushions on beds. They get thrown on the floor when you sleep and then thrown back on the bed when you don't. They aren't of any practical use.

Perhaps a decorative (but not too large) wall mirror even if you have a mirrored door on the fitted wardrobe.
Crisp white bedlinen but colourful throw and/or cushions, the latter not necessarily on the bed!
Comfortable chair with footstool if you have the space for it?

I'd add plants of different sizes and types in some beautiful pots. They always make a room less soulless and more homely (an issue with newly painted and decluttered rooms IMO). If you go for lush and large it can help create a luxurious feel.
I also think rooms look underdressed until they have a few pictures or paintings on the wall.
